Climate Change
Treaty

As the UN requires that countries should by 31 January 2010 approve the Copenhagen Accord and append their own goals for cutting carbon emissions or slowing emissions growth by 2020, China, together with other major developing nations, stressed that only the industrialised countries need to make internationally binding commitments and that the efforts by developing countries to slow the climate change would be voluntary steps. Environmental advocates say, however, that China is forging ahead with its own plans to become more carbon-efficient. Later, China agreed to join the Copenhagen Accord by submitting a a single-sentence letter saying that the UN “can proceed to include China in the list of parties” signed up under the accord.
